This started as a club project. The project was that everyone got the same decal sheet and put it on any subject they wanted. The decal sheet is the local provincial police (OPP). I originally was not going to do it but then during a conversation with a couple of friend the idea of a Pink Pig came up. The actual story behind the Pink Pig is that in 1971 there was a race team that could not get sponsorship for their race car which was a Porsche 917-20. As a lark they painted the car pink and labeled various sections of the car as body parts of a real pig if it was to be cut up. The pig reference also relates to the police car.
